what you’ll be doing:
• architecting and delivering mid to large scale enterprise applications on microsoft platform.
• recommending and participating in activities related to the design, development and maintenance of the enterprise application architecture.
delivering projects on time with quality.
• provide technical leadership regarding technology or project to customers and team members
• shares best practices, lessons learned and constantly updates the technical system architecture requirements based on changing technologies and knowledge related to recent, current and up-coming vendor products and solutions.
• participate in technical forums and discussion within the team and with clients.
• guides and mentors’ team in terms of technical solutioning.
• release preparation (booking deployments, change advisory board, version setup and coordination etc.)
• lead, facilitate and encourage code reviews and peer programming – look for areas of opportunity for team members and identify ways to help them improve
• adopt and adhere to standard development practices like continuous integration, static code analysis, unit testing and versioning.
• continuously evaluate and drive measurable improvements to processes, platforms, tools, and related technologies; provide necessary trainings to communicate changes and measure
• create an environment that promotes collaborative learning and collective ownership of responsibilities.
• collaborates with cross-functional teams to ensure timely delivery of projects.
• coordinates project resources across multiple locations and time zones.
what you’ll bring to the team:
• you have 12+ years of experience in strong design & coding experience in framework using design patterns & oops concepts.
• you have practical knowledge & good understanding of cross technology and functional domains, programming concepts and logical approach for problem solving.
you hold rich experience on web development technologies including , mvc5, javascript, jquery, html5, ajax, xml and css.
• you have experience in web application architecture and development with hands on expertise in delivering solutions, customizing c#, applications using development tools like visual studio 2010/2012.
• you have the exposure to emerging web technologies like , angularjs, project polymer and iot, and ability to make recommendations suitable for the current and future needs.
• you have solid knowledge of oops concepts, ooad, with .net framework / or above and web/window services.
• you have experience in rdbms like sql server 2008/above & database programming skills including creating stored procedures, views using pl/sql.
• you have knowledge of third-party tools like nunit, ncover, cruise control, fxcop.
• you have knowledge of design patterns, uml, tdd/bdd and best software development practices
• you have knowledge and experience with microsoft .net technologies like wcf, wwf, wpf, linq
• you have knowledge and/or experience in other microsoft technologies such as crm and sql server technologies – ssrs, ssis, ssas
• you have experience with agile development methodologies including kanban and scrum
• you have experience with source control management systems and continuous integration/deployment environments like tfs, svn etc.
Experience
14 - 17 Years
No. of Openings
2
Education
B.C.A, B.Sc, B.E, B.Tech, M.C.A, M.Sc, M.Tech
Role
Dot Net Architect
Industry Type
Insurance / Claims
Gender
[ Male / Female ]
Job Country
India
Type of Job
Full Time
Work Location Type
Work from Office